Output 070c66f1b3c4641596e040d142c291551014379ea24a10ccf6a4dfeb075baf5c:8

value
3221627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a60ebd1c21be2320d069302867363a88bfc2b07 OP_EQUAL
address
3HDtuMbH97BJ8z7d597QynNi16gX9SRGGS
transaction
070c66f1b3c4641596e040d142c291551014379ea24a10ccf6a4dfeb075baf5c
spent
true